Europlacer, the global leader in flexible SMT assembly solutions, has appointed Craig Brown as Sales Director for Europlacer Americas, effective October 6, 2025.

Brown brings more than 20 years of experience in sales and leadership roles within the electronics manufacturing industry. Most recently, he served as General Manager at SAKI North America, where he oversaw business development and operations across the region. His career also includes an earlier role as Regional Sales Manager at Europlacer Americas, as well as eight years as Sales Manager for the Americas at DEK USA, where he directed sales efforts across the U.S., Mexico, Canada, Brazil, and Costa Rica.

Earlier in his career, Brown owned and managed TechSearch LLC, building new territories and fostering long-term customer relationships throughout the Americas. Known for presenting at national and international sales meetings, he has consistently demonstrated the ability to grow teams, expand market reach, and deliver results in diverse environments.

“In line with market trends, we continue to strengthen our customer-facing team with individuals that bring experience, curiosity and passion for customer success.said Andrei Stapinoiu, Director of Global Sales.Craig brings all these values and a comprehensive set of skills that will ensure our customers receive the best service in the industry.”
